The EE British Academy Film Awards—or BAFTAs—were held this past weekend, and it was nearly a clean sweep for Sam Mendes’ one-shot World War I drama 1917, which won all but two awards it was nominated for. That included Best Film, Best Director, and of course Best Cinematography, but the film's success in other below-the-line categories like Best Production Design, Sound, and Special Visual Effects has many wondering if we just got a preview of what Oscars night might have in store on Sunday, February 9th.
